President of the Legislative Assembly of RR announces organizing body for public competition

The Legislative Assembly of Roraima has selected the Carlos Chagas Foundation to organize its fourth public competition for 225 job positions.

The Legislative Assembly of Roraima (Ale-RR) has officially selected the Carlos Chagas Foundation as the organizing body for its upcoming public competition, which will offer 225 immediate positions in various educational levels. This decision was made during the session held on January 24, 2026. Ale-RR's president, Soldier Sampaio, expressed the importance of recruiting qualified professionals to enhance the state's development and strengthen the Assembly's workforce.

The immediate job openings will cater to candidates with middle, technical, and higher education qualifications, emphasizing a diverse range of opportunities. Soldier Sampaio stated that the contract with the Carlos Chagas Foundation would be finalized promptly following the session's conclusion, highlighting the foundation's credibility and historic success in managing public competitions throughout Brazil.

The announcement not only signifies a strategic step toward strengthening the administrative capabilities of the Roraima State Assembly but also reflects the ongoing efforts to professionalize public service in the region, ensuring that qualified personnel are appointed. The planned competition is expected to conclude within the year, ultimately resulting in the formal induction of the selected candidates into the Assembly.
